Types of Banks in Jordan

Jordan's banking sector comprises local commercial banks, Islamic banks, and international branches. Leading local banks such as Arab Bank, Jordan Kuwait Bank, and Bank al Etihad provide comprehensive financial services including current accounts, savings products, and international remittances. Islamic banks like Jordan Islamic Bank offer Sharia-compliant financial solutions. International presence includes institutions like HSBC and Citibank serving corporate and high-net-worth clients. The Jordanian Dinar (JOD) is the primary currency, with most banks offering online banking platforms and mobile apps for convenient account management.


How to Open a Bank Account in Jordan

Opening a bank account in Jordan requires specific documentation and typically involves in-person visits to bank branches. Requirements generally include:

  • Valid passport with residence permit (iqama)
  • Proof of Jordanian address (rental contract or utility bill)
  • Evidence of employment or income source
  • Initial deposit ranging from 10 JOD to 100 JOD

The process usually takes 3-7 business days, with monthly maintenance fees between 2-5 JOD. Most banks require minimum balances to avoid additional charges, and international transfers incur fees of 15-30 JOD per transaction.


Multi-Currency and International Banking Services

Jordanian banks offer multi-currency accounts primarily in USD and EUR, alongside JOD accounts. While useful for businesses and frequent travelers, these accounts often involve high exchange rate margins (3-5%) and substantial transfer fees. International banking services are available but may require additional documentation and longer processing times.
